Which one of the following does not contain any delocalised electrons?

poly(propene)

benzene

graphite

sodium

The nitration of benzene uses a nitrating mixture of concentrated nitric acid and concentrated sulfuric acid.


HNO3 + 2H2SO4 → NO2+ + H3O+ + 2HSO4


Which statement is correct?

HNO3 acts as a base.

HNO3 acts as a catalyst.

HNO3 acts as an electrophile.

HNO3 acts as a reducing agent.

In a reaction which gave a 27.0% yield, 5.00 g of methylbenzene were converted into the explosive 2,4,6-trinitromethylbenzene (TNT) (Mr = 227.0). The mass of TNT formed was

1.35 g

3.33 g

3.65 g

12.34 g
